What is IV therapy?
IV therapy delivers fluids directly through an intravenous line and can include selected vitamins and nutrients depending on the treatment plan.

What is IV therapy like?
Most IV therapy appointments are straightforward and relaxing. After a brief review and assessment, your drip is started in a comfortable chair and runs over a set period of time depending on the treatment selected.
